I have a newsgroup which I started a couple of years ago. About 15 names. I want to send all 15 of them as blind copies (no e-mail addresses showing). When I type the name of the newsgroup and hit "Bcc," what happens is that it comes to me, as first on the list, as a Bcc, but everyone else's address is showing.

Anyone know how I can change that? Thanks in advance.
 
 cherishedclutter
 
posted on September 2, 2010 11:16:11 AM new
have you got another email address you can use as a test? Open up a free yahoo account if you have to.

I'm thinking send it to that address as bcc and then open it up. You might find that all of the addresses are only showing up on your "sent" view, not on the "received" view.

That's how it works in my outlook email.
